§ 8-3-2-6 — Carload freight shipments; billings; records; freight cars requested and furnished

Indiana·Art. 3 RAILROADS GENERALLY·Ch. 2 Operation of Freight Railroads
Each carrier subject to this chapter shall provide and permanently keep at each billing station on its line in Indiana where it handles carload shipments a substantially bound book, which shall be in the form prescribed by the Indiana department of transportation, suitable for permanently recording and preserving the information required by this section and other information as the department may prescribe concerning the subject matter of this chapter. Any applicant for cars for use at a station shall record in the book the date of application showing the number and kind of cars required, when required, for what kind of loading, the point of destination, and other information as the department prescribes.
